ASP×Ô¶¯Ê¶±ðIP,²¢Ìø×ªµ½À´·ÃÎÊÕßËùÔڵijÇÊÐ
×Ô¶¯Ê¶±ðIP,²¢Ìø×ªµ½À´·ÃÎÊÕßËùÔڵijÇÊÐ
ÏÈÈ¥ÏÂÒ»¸ö×îеĴ¿ÕæIPÊý¾Ý¿â,È»ºó°´ÈçϲÙ×÷:
1.ÔËÐд¿ÕæQQIPÊý¾Ý¿âÀï´øµÄShowIP.exe£¬µã½âѹ£¬ÊäÈëÎļþÃû£¬±ÈÈçIP.txt£¬È·¶¨£¬¾ÍµÃµ½Ò»¸öTXTÎļþ¡£
2.´ò¿ªACCESS£¬¹¤¾ß£×Ô¶¨Ò壬ÃüÁîÑ¡Ï£¬°Ñµ¼ÈëÑ¡ÏîÍ϶¯µ½ÉÏÃæµÄ¹¤¾ßÀ¸¡£
3.½¨¿â£¬½¨Ò»¸ö±í£¬Ëĸö×Ö¶Î
Startip ÀàÐÍ:Îı¾ (Ïà¹Ø³ÇÊеÄIP¶ÎÐÅÏ¢)
Endip ÀàÐÍ:Îı¾ (Ïà¹Ø³ÇÊеÄIP¶ÎÐÅÏ¢)
Country ÀàÐÍ:Îı¾ (Ïà¹Ø³ÇÊÐÃû³Æ)
ReUrl ÀàÐÍ:Îı¾ (ÄãÏëÒªÌø×ªµÄ³ÇÊз¾¶Èç:±±¾© http://bj.abc.com)
4.µãµ¼Èë°´Å¥£¬ÎļþÀàÐÍÑ¡Îı¾Îļþ£¬ÕÒµ½¸Õ²Åµ¼³öµÄIP.txtÎļþ£¬µ¼Èëµ½¸Õ²Å½¨µÄ±íÀï~
ÔËËã½«ÕæÊµIPת»»ÎªÊý×Ö,±ÈÈç±±¾©µÄIP¶ÎÊÇ £º 1.1.0.0 -- 1.1.0.255
Startip: 1*256*256*256+1*256*256+0*256+0 = 16842752 (Õâ¸öÊý×Ö²ÅÊÇ×îÖÕÒª·Åµ½Êý¾Ý¿âÀï)
Endip: 1*256*256*256+1*256*256+0*256+255 = 16843007 (Õâ¸öÊý×Ö²ÅÊÇ×îÖÕÒª·Åµ½Êý¾Ý¿âÀïµÄ)
¿ÉÓóÌÐòÅúÁ¿´¦Àí,Èç¹û²»»á,¶øÇÒûʱ¼ä(ÏñÎÒÒ»Ñù)Äã¾ÍÖ±½Óȥϸö¶¯ÍøµÄIP¿â,ËüÊÇÒѾ´¦ÀíºÃÁ˵Ä,ÏÂÃæÊdzÌÐò²¿·Ö:
user_ip = Request.ServerVariables("REMOTE_ADDR") ''È¡µÃ·ÃÎÊÕßIP
userip_ary=split(user_ip,".")
tmp_userip=userip_ary(0)*256*256*256+userip_ary(1)*256*256+userip_ary(2)*256+userip_ary(3) '' °´¹æ¶¨×ª»»IPΪÊý×Ö
'´ÓÊý¾Ý¿âÕÒ³öÓû§IPÊôÓڵijÇÊÐ
set rs=Server.CreateObject("ADODB.Recordset")
sql="select * from ip where Startip<="&tmp_userip&" and Endip>="&tmp_userip
rs.open sql,conn,1,1
if rs.eof then
response.redirect "index.asp" ’Èç¹ûûÓиóÇÊлòÊÇIPÎÞ·¨Ê¶±ðÔòתµ½Ê×Ò³,Ò²¿ÉÒÔÖ¸¶¨Ò³Ãæ
else
response.redirect rs("ReUrl") ’Èç¹ûÓÐתµ½Ö¸¶¨Ò³Ãæ
end if
rs.close
set rs=nothing
½«ÉÏÃæµÄ³ÌÐò·Åµ½ÄãµÄÐéÄâÖ÷»úĬÈÏ·ÃÎÊÊ×Ò³Àï!»òÊÇÆäËüµÄÒ³ÃæÀï(µ±È»ÄãͬÑùÒªÔÚÐéÄâÖ÷»ú¿ØÖÆÃæ°åÀïÉèÖÃĬÈÏÊ×ÏÈ·ÃÎʵÄÊÇÕâ¸öÎļþ)
Ïà¹ØÎĵµ£º
1¡¢ÔËÐл·¾³ÓëÈí¼þÒªÇó
Windows 2000 ÒÔÉÏ £¨²»°üÀ¨Windows XP Home°æ£©
IIS 4.0 ÒÔÉÏ
Microsoft Access 2000
Dreamweaver MX
2¡¢IISµÄ°²×°ÓëÅäÖÃ
a.°²×°IIS
Èô²Ù×÷ϵͳÖл¹Î´°²×°IIS·þÎñÆ÷£¬¿É´ò¿ª“¿ØÖÆÃæ°å”£¬È»ºóµ¥»÷Æô¶¯ “Ìí¼Ó/ɾ³ý³ÌÐò”£¬ ÔÚµ¯³öµÄ¶Ô»°¿òÖÐÑ¡Ôñ “Ìí¼Ó/ɾ³ýWi ......
¾¹ý±¾È˽«ASPÔËÐÐËÙ¶ÈÄÚ´æÕ¼ÓôóС·Å´óµ½200MµÄ²âÊÔ
¹ØÓÚ¶¨Òå±äÁ¿£º
1¡¢¶¨Òå±äÁ¿£¬¾¡Á¿²»Òª¶¨ÒåÈ«¾Ö±äÁ¿£¬Ë½ÓбäÁ¿ÔÚÔËÐÐËÙ¶ÈÒÔ¼°¿Õ¼äÕ¼ÓÃÉÏÃæ±È¹«¹²±äÁ¿Ëٶȿ죬ÒÔ¼°¸³ÖµÉÏÃæËÙ¶ÈÎÊÌ⣨ÏÂÃæ½éÉÜ£©
2¡¢±äÁ¿¸³Öµ£º
¸ø±äÁ¿¸³Öµ¾¡Á¿Ò»´Î¸³Í꣬±ÈÈ磺
Dim str
str="1"
str ......
³ý·ÇÄúÒÔϵͳÕÊ»§µÄÉí·ÝµÇ½µ½·þÎñÆ÷£¨ÔÚä¯ÀÀÆ÷»·¾³ÖÐÒ²ÊÇ¿ÉÒÔʵÏÖ£©£¬»òÕßÖ÷»ú¶Ë½øÐÐÁËÁ¼ºÃµÄȨÏÞÅäÖ㬷ñÔò±¾ÎÄÉæ¼°µÄ¹¦ÄÜÊǺÜÄÑʵÏֵġ£ÒòΪÎÒÃÇͨ¹ýiis·ÃÎÊij¸öÒ³ÃæÊ±£¬Ò»°ãÊÇiisÄäÃûÕÊ»§µÄÉí·Ý£¬ÔÚ´ó¶àÊýÇé¿öÏ£¬aspµÄWScript.ShellÊDZ»½ûÓõģ¬ÒòΪËüÓкܴóµÄ°²È«Òþ»¼¡£
¡¡¡¡ÒªÏëʵÏÖÕâÖÖ¹¦ÄÜ£¬Ê×ÏÈÒªµÃµ½Rar³ ......
¶ÔÓÚÒ»¸öÏëѧºÃASP¼°asp.netµÄ¹ýÀ´ÈËÀ´Ëµ,ѧϰµÄ¹ý³ÌÊÇÓÐȤ¼°ÕÛÄ¥È˵Ä,µ±Äã×ö³öµÚÒ»¸öʵÑéµÄʱºòÄãµÄÐÄÇéÊǼ¤¶¯µÄ,ÎÒÊDZÏÒµÒÔÀ´Ò»²½Ò»²½µÄ×Ôѧ¹ý³ÌÖÐ×ܽáÁËһЩºÃµÄ¾ÑéÈÿ´µ½ÕâÆªÎÄÕµÄÈËÉÙ×ßһЩÍä·,ÏÂÃæÐ´µÄ¶¼ÊÇÕë¶Ô³õѧÕß,Ò²ÊÇÎÒ×Ô¼ºÊÇÔõô´ÓÁã»ù´¡µ½ÏÖÔÚ¿ÉÒÔ¿ª·¢Ò»Ð©¶«Î÷µÄ¹ý³Ì.
&nb ......